    I have an older computer and lag can be a problem from multiple points from me. (PC/ISP/SE SRV) I found some things that helped me.
    -In {System Settings} & {Character Settings} : I adjusted the amount of stuff i request to load like people and effect animations. At first this sounds like a loss, but, in all reality I didn't change the textures for the world or my own char. So i don't notice a difference.
    -Frame Limiting : I set this aside as it may have nothing to do with anything. I set mine to limit because it would go from 35+ to 0 to 5 to 0 to 18 ..... etc and it almost seemed like it would pull to high top out crash and have a seizure, and limiting it and then restarting the client has stopped it from Seizen up. I still get a few slight jumps but overall smooth
    -Misc Stuff : i use an Application Called Razor (Sorry for naming a product ) but its a game booster and when i launch FF XIV with it it will cut all un needed stuff running in my computer and free up Phys mem and CPU load . It has helped . Not saying get that program but looking at your Physical Memories load % & your CPU's Load% freeing up space and clutter always helps even the best pc.

    There are known issues amongst the various ISP's involved in getting data back and forth between your client and the your world service. Uunless you are right there in Montreal and use PSInet or Ormuco for Internet, you likely use at least 3 ISP's along the way. It has been covered extensively on these forums and elsewhere. If you haven't done so yet, may want to run some tests to rule that out. TATA (AS6453) recently had big issues with some corridors in the north east, and Level3 has been known to have issues off and on for years... Cogent is a bit better, but isn't immune to such problems either. Same goes to Verizon's ALTER.NET and GTT's TiNet/SPA segments. Those are 5 of the major ISP's with whom Ormuco has peering agreements, and who most of us ultimately wind up using to get to SE.

    So.. if you see their names along your route at hops exhibiting issues, they are likely the culprit or at least heavily invested in the problem. More often than not, it would be your ISP that would need to address the problem, as they are the ones who established the route that is putting you on that hop in the first place. They can either work to address the problems along that route, or switch you to alternate routing to try to avoid the troubled segment. All of this falls under your ISP's influence far more than SE could ever exert towards a solution.

    The exception of course is when the problems occur only on the other side of those third/fourth party exchanges and are fully within Ormuco or SE's segments. Ormuco is SE's ISP, so from that point forward, SE would likely get better results trying to get things addressed. To that end... SE has been announcing planned maintenance by Ormuco, as well as maintenance of their own. One Ormuco maintenance had been postponed a couple times, but appears to have finally been completed last night--but another is pending this weekend (check the Lodestone for the time frame). Ormuco has done this a few times in the past and has addressed some of the congestion/stability issues that were found within their sphere of influence. With any luck, such will be the case again.

    If after this maintenance completes you still have issues and you have not either diagnosed your route yourself or had your ISP seriously investigate it (as in, you typically need to be dealing with Tier3 support (sometimes referred to as Engineering) and not the guys that answer the 800 number or the techs that come on site--if your ISP has an online support portal, it usually gets you to those higher tiers faster), you really need to check out your route--either doing it yourself or getting your ISP involved..

    I will note that since the FCC passed that reclassing of Internet, things have gotten better. Before the reclass, I was getting 2-3 seconds of lag on everything. After the reclass, I'm down to 1-2 seconds of lag.

    Issue is not my PC...
    As you can see, PC is more then able. Temps are high 60s/Low 70s under prime95 load.

    Using a VPN program (WTFast for example) all lag is removed. This rules out the FF14 servers as the culprit as the lag would be present regardless what I do.

    Seems Tata Communications is to blame. Before the reclass, I would be at 32ms every jump until Palo Alto. From there, I would jump to 100ms+ per jump after and get a 15-30% packet loss during non-peak hours at Palo Alto.
